Job Description

The Barney School of Business is seeking candidates for a Tenure Track Assistant Professor of Sports Management to teach courses in Sports Management and related subjects. The successful candidate will be a dynamic teacher, a productive scholar and an enthusiastic service provider.

Essential Job Duties

The successful applicant will teach courses in the new Sports Management Program, as well as other business school courses that correspond to their expertise and experience as the need arises. There will also be opportunities to teach in our innovative University Interdisciplinary Studies program. An active scholarly/research/agenda with peer-reviewed publications, presentations, or other accomplishments related to sports management program disciplines are expected for successful tenure and promotion. Service to the department, college, and university is expected and will include advising business school students from other business areas but will focus primarily on Sports Management students. An opportunity exists to further develop the curriculum and Sports Management program. Applicants should describe in their letter of intent how their teaching and/or scholarship will advance intercultural competence in all students. Candidates are encouraged to describe any particular expertise in curriculum development related to equity, diversity, and social justice in Sports Management.

Required Qualifications

Required: A Doctorate in a Business Discipline from an AACSB accredited school or equivalent business education accreditation body is required. Applicants must also document an interest and capability of research and publication in the Sports Management area. ABDs will be considered providing they document a degree completion date. Applicants not meeting this qualification may not be hired.

Preferred: In addition to a doctoral degree and research potential in the sports management related area, the ideal candidate will have experience teaching sport management or related courses and demonstrate the ability to engage with the sports community. Candidates should also be familiar with technology-supported learning pedagogy and be able to integrate technology into their teaching. Experience working with under-represented populations will be a plus.

University of Hartford serves approximately 6000 students in undergraduate and graduate programs across seven colleges, offering the personal attention associated with a small college enhanced by the expertise, breadth and intellectual excitement of a university. Students at the University of Hartford find success in a learning environment that both challenges and mentors them. Our academic mission is to engage students in acquiring the knowledge, skills, and values necessary to thrive in, and contribute to, a pluralistic, complex world. The full text of our academic mission can be seen at www.hartford.edu. The University of Hartford is located within the greater Hartford area, which is rich in cultural and recreational activities, and is a short drive from metropolitan Boston and New York.
